Bitcoin Drops to $78,000 as Rate Hike Fears Spark $550M Long Position Liquidation
Bitcoin fell to $78,000 as fears of interest rate hikes triggered a massive $550 million flush of long leveraged positions
TLDR
- โBitcoin dropped to $78,000 following $550M long position liquidation from rate hike fears
- โECB and US yield pressure triggered largest single-session long flush in recent months
- โRisk-off environment across crypto assets due to sustained interest rate hike concerns
